Understanding E-E Architecture

Electronic/Electrical architecture in vehicles refers to the network of hardware and software components that control and manage electrical power distribution, signal processing, and data communication throughout the vehicle. Modern E-E architectures move beyond traditional distributed designs to zonal, domain-based, and centralized computing topologies that support adv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), infotainment, over-the-air (OTA) updates, and vehicle-to-everything (V2X) connectivity.

Trends Shaping the Future

  • Shift to Domain and Zonal Controllers: Centralizing processing into fewer, powerful electronic control units (ECUs) or zonal controllers is improving system efficiency and reducing vehicle weight.

  • Increased Use of Ethernet Backbone: Automotive Ethernet is replacing traditional CAN/LIN buses for high-speed data transfer to support ADAS and infotainment systems.

  • Artificial Intelligence Integration: AI and machine learning are increasingly embedded into E-E architectures to enhance decision-making for autonomous systems and predictive maintenance.

  • Cybersecurity Focus: With vehicles becoming more software-centric and connected, securing E-E networks against cyber threats is a key area of innovation.

FAQs: E-E Architecture Market

Q1: What is the primary purpose of E-E architecture in modern vehicles?
A1: E-E architecture serves as the central nervous system of a vehicle, managing electrical power and data flows across safety, connectivity, control, and infotainment systems to support advanced functionalities.

Q2: Why are automakers transitioning to zonal and centralized architectures?
A2: Zonal and centralized architectures help streamline wiring harnesses, reduce vehicle weight, lower production costs, improve computing efficiency, and facilitate software updates and modular system upgrades throughout the vehicle lifecycle.

Q3: How does E-E architecture impact electric and autonomous vehicle development?
A3: It provides the foundation for battery management, power distribution, sensor fusion, ADAS capabilities, and connectivity solutions required for efficient EV performance and higher levels of autonomy.
